Transaction 164863beac66091ec93052577b2b5ed0fa26efc5c48f7a3b913243294f543f06
1 Input
1 Output
-
164863beac66091ec93052577b2b5ed0fa26efc5c48f7a3b913243294f543f06:0
- value
- 169422
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1bdad4205dfeb66dea73ee29ab7e519d024bb43c OP_EQUAL
- address
- 34EJKCgLz1dEEnHyQ1dXFDoc4C8UU5eaXm